EFFECT OF PLUME DYNAMICS FOR HEAT TRANSFER ENHANCEMENT AT SOLID-LIQUID INTERFACE

Subudhi, Sudhakar and Arakeri, Jaywant H (2014) EFFECT OF PLUME DYNAMICS FOR HEAT TRANSFER ENHANCEMENT AT SOLID-LIQUID INTERFACE. In: ASME International Mechanical Engineering Congress and Exposition (IMECE2013), NOV 15-21, 2013, San Diego, CA.

Abstract

The present paper analyzes the effects of plumes for heat transfer enhancement at solid-liquid interface taking both smooth and grooved surfaces. The experimental setup consists of a tank of dimensions 265 x 265 x 300 (height) containing water. The bottom surface was heated and free surface of the water was left open to the ambient. In the experiments, the bottom plate had either a smooth surface or a grooved surface. We used 90 V-grooved rough surfaces with two groove heights, 10mm and 3mm. The experiment was done with water layer depths of 90mm and 140mm, corresponding to values of aspect ratio(AR) equal to 2.9 and 1.8 respectively. Thymol blue, a pH sensitive dye, was used to visualize the flow near the heated plate. The measured heat transfer coefficients over the grooved surfaces were higher compared that over the smooth surface. The enhanced heat transport in the rough cavities cannot be ascribed to the increase in the contact area, rather it must be the local dynamics of the thermal boundary layer that changes the heat transport over the rough surface.
